This is a simple process for you to transfer money from Malaysia to India online:

Compare options

Each provider has different strengths. Please specify whether you want to receive cash or bank transfer to find yourself a suitable supplier.

Sign up for an account

You’ll need to give your name, address, contact details, ID proof, and payment method.

Provide recipient details

Enter the recipient’s name and your contact information. For example, if you want to send money directly to an Indian account, you need to provide their account number, SWIFT, or IBAN, along with their bank branch address.

Enter the amount to transfer

If you are satisfied with the fees, exchange rate, and transfer speed, you will proceed to enter the amount to be transferred. Many services give the India Rupee your recipient should receive, so double-check this.

Complete the transfer

Send your money to India. Keep any reference number safe to track your transfer – your recipient may need it too.

If you send it to an Indian bank account, your recipient must wait for the funds to arrive. For a cash pick-up, your India recipient will need to show a photo ID to pick up the funds. You must also give them the transaction reference number to streamline the process.

Methods of transfer money from Malaysia to India online

Bank transfer to India: Most banks will allow you to transfer money internationally online through a branch or by phone. For example, money will be sent directly from your bank account to your recipient’s local bank account in your chosen currency.

Send money online to India: if you want to make MYR/INR payments online or using your smartphone, you can choose your bank’s online banking or international payments specialist. Transferring money online can offer better exchange rates and lower fees than banks.

Money transfer service

Many people trust this international money transfer method because of its ease, convenience, and reasonable cost. In addition, the cost per transaction made through the service is very suitable, if you use the monthly package, it is much cheaper.

You can transfer money to India using your bank, a dedicated money transfer service, an e-wallet, or a physical money transfer shop. Each option has different pros and cons, so your best choice will depend on your specific personal and transfer requirements.

Notes when transferring money from Malaysia to India

Exchange rate: the mid-market rate is the rate banks, and money transfer services use to transact with each other. But not all money transfer providers tell you the average rate in this market. So compare this rate between suppliers with the average market rate to find the price that will benefit you the most.

Transfer fee: each provider will have a different fixed price when transferring money from Malaysia to India. Usually, if you transfer money more, the cost will be cheaper.

Transfer limits: find out how much you can send in each transfer. For example, one provider may limit your deposit to only $10,000 while another may allow you to transfer up to $1 million.

Transfer type: Does your recipient have a Malaysian bank account, or is cash or cell phone top-up the better option? Each type of transfer will have a different fee. For example, if you want to receive cash, it will be more expensive than a bank transfer.

Discount: depending on each provider will be different forms of discount, such as free for first transfer money or discount if you transfer more than a certain amount.

How long does it take to transfer money to India?

The length of time it takes to transfer money to India depends on various factors, including the provider you use, how you’re paying, and how you want your recipient to get the money in the end. It may take 1-3 days.
